Study of skates and sharks questions assumptions about 'essential' genes (December 16, 2011) -- Biologists have long assumed that all jawed vertebrates possess a full complement of nearly identical genes for critical aspects of their development. But new research shows that elasmobranchs, a subclass of cartilaginous fishes, lack a cluster of genes, HoxC, formerly thought to be essential for proper development. ... > full story

Close family ties keep cheaters in check: Why almost all multicellular organisms begin life as a single cell (December 16, 2011) -- Any multicellular animal poses a special difficulty for the theory of evolution. Most of its cells will die without reproducing, and only a privileged few will pass their genes. Given the incentive for cheating, how is cooperation among the cells enforced? Evolutionary biologists suggest the answer is frequent population bottlenecks that restart populations from a single cell. ... > full story
